WebThe two other possible values for background-size are contain and cover.. The contain keyword scales the background image to be as large as possible (but both its width and its height must fit inside the content area). how much sleep should an adult haveWebJan 12, 2024 · A child div inside a container can be made to take the complete width and height of the parent div. There are two methods to stretch the div to fit the container using CSS that are discussed below: Method 1: First method is to simply assign 100% width and 100% height to the child div so that it will take all available space of the parent div.
